// MIGRATION_BATCH_SIZE governs the Tidemark backfill worker during
// zero-downtime schema changes. Keep it at or below 1000: larger
// batches hold row locks long enough to starve live reads on the
// Corvell primary. Raised cautiously only after the sync reviews
// lock-wait metrics. Last validated against the build token below.

session token of tajef-bageg = htk21_5d90d574934f3ccae6437

TICKET: Planner regression traced to config drift

Welcome aboard — quick context. The Quillbase query planner started choosing nested-loop joins on the reporting replicas last week. Root cause is config drift: someone tuned cost parameters on one replica during an incident and the change spread via an unreviewed snapshot. Your task is to restore parity with the committed baseline and add a drift check to CI. The drifted replica currently reports these values.

config for kafof-bawef:
holath:
  log_level: debug
  metrics_host: metrics.holath.qorvelsys.internal
  pin: 2191
  pool_size: 32

## Support

So you've hit a 429 from Gatewren, our internal API gateway. Don't panic — it's almost always the per-team rate bucket, not a bug. Check the quota dashboard first; your team's limits are listed under your service name. Retries with exponential backoff usually smooth things over. If you genuinely need a higher limit, file a quota request and tag the Gateway crew — they review them every Tuesday. For urgent throttling issues blocking production, just email the team directly at the address below.

billing contact of yawip-yadup = druath.casdor@nelvrolabs.internal